Description:

Client is seeking an Industrial Maintenance Electrical Technician V - Journeyman to join our operations & maintenance team.

This position is responsible for acting as a subject matter expert as a qualified Industrial Electrician: troubleshooting, installation, and documenting the electrical and control needs of facility switch gear, breaker panels, lighting, and process equipment in an industrial environment.

This position is directly responsible for maintaining and assisting site engineering teams to meet site electrical needs.

Responsibilities:

- Maintain current and future plant electrical systems.

- Support plant electrical expansion projects

- Must be able to adhere to Federal, State and Local electrical code and be familiar with NFPA70e.

- Assist in designing electrical systems.

- Repair all plant electrical items

- Work alongside Electrical service company, engineers, and plant leadership to ensure local grid is functioning at peak capacity.

- May be required to maintain and improve control systems, install electrical sub panels/services, and buss plugs.

- Diagnoses, troubleshoots, maintains, and repairs process/production machines, equipment, and related electrical equipment, such as electrical control circuits from instrumentation devices, PLCs / ladder logic controllers, and variable frequency drives as necessary.

- Effectively communicates with the site management team and the customer to understand requirements, solve complex electrical problems, and provide solutions to manufacturing problems.

- Demonstrates ability to identify and correct any safety-related issues and perform independent equipment evaluations to identify potential equipment failures.

- Procures parts from crib systems, OEM, or authorized vendors.

- Utilizes strong electrical skills in order to complete assignments.

- Creates and modifies site operations procedures for equipment and recommends facilities reliability improvements.

- Provides instruction, mentors, and trains less skilled technicians as needed.

- Performs preventive maintenance on process/production equipment as scheduled in the Computerized Maintenance Management System (CMMS).

- Responds and provides service and feedback to the customer on all work orders while assuring compliance to codes, regulations, and industry standards.

- Safely performs functions of the position including following proper safety guidelines such as job hazard analysis and lockout/tagout procedures and wearing PPE as required.

- Operates various measuring, diagnostic and testing instruments to help provide energy efficiency solutions.

- Operates a variety of equipment such as hand tools, laptop computers and diagnostic hardware to perform work.

- Maintains a strict schedule to be successful in the assignment yet demonstrates flexibility in the day-to-day activities and scheduling for the benefit of the customer.

Minimum Requirements:

High school diploma or demonstrated equivalent.

Must be a U.S. Citizen.

Current Oregon State Electrical License (LME) or a reciprocal Journeyman License from Oregon.

Qualified applicants who are offered a position must pass a pre-employment background check and substance abuse test.

This position will require the ability to obtain a security access badge at our client's location.

6 years' experience as an electrician in an industrial environment, maintenance shop, or manufacturing facility.

Experience with repair on electrical equipment in an industrial environment or demonstrated equivalent combination of education and experience.

Must have the ability to work in an aerial lift or scissor lift at heights up to 30 feet or higher.

Must be self-motivated and demonstrate the strong organizational/time management skills needed to be successful in this role.

Preferred Qualifications:

Experience diagnosing, troubleshooting, and repairing industrial production systems such as switchgear, MCC's, and Capacitor banks.

Experience working around chemicals, precision equipment and highly regulated materials and equipment.

Experience trouble shooting complex electrical systems.

Experience diagnosing, troubleshooting, and repairing pumps, motors, gearboxes, supply and exhaust fans, power transmission components.

Experience troubleshooting and repairing cranes and hoists.

Experience utilizing measurement tools such as micrometers, dial indicators, various type gauges, and calibers to set tolerances to OEM Specifications.
